Statistics show that it is unlikely (or it won't happen) that Black Americans will have equal rights (aka the same rights) compared to white people.  Surveys have been taken and 78% of Black people think that the country isn’t doing enough for them to have equal rights.  According to opinion polls during this last presidency, it has been more common for people to share racially insensitive views. This podcast episode highlights the struggles that Black Americans who are descendants of American chattel slaves endure in their mission to get true equal rights.  #WeAreTheFuture #TakeActionProject
